Definitions and Meaning of retaliate in English
retaliate (v)
take revenge for a perceived wrong
make a counterattack and return like for like, especially evil for evil
retaliate (v. t.)
To return the like for; to repay or requite by an act of the same kind; to return evil for (evil). [Now seldom used except in a bad sense.]
retaliate (v. i.)
To return like for like; specifically, to return evil for evil; as, to retaliate upon an enemy.
